Noctis — Analysis of shadow dreams, recurring symbols and hidden needs
Noctis is the advisor you consult when a dream persists. When a scene returns, when a place repeats itself, when a presence follows you without explanation, or when you wake with a sensation stronger than the image itself. His work is not to "translate" dreams like a universal dictionary. He first identifies recurring patterns, then searches for what they protect, what they demand, and what they try to avoid. Noctis explores what is called the shadow: not something bad, but what has been set aside, repressed, denied, or simply overlooked through adaptation.
His method is simple and demanding: start with the concrete (images, actions, dream rhythm), move toward emotion (fear, shame, desire, anger, relief), then identify the hidden need (security, autonomy, recognition, repair, boundaries, truth). A dream is not a prediction. It is an alert system. And a recurring symbol is rarely "a message"—it is rather a gentle alarm that keeps triggering until you change an inner parameter. Noctis helps you see which parameter.
Recurring symbols: what persists wants to be heard
Shadow dreams often organize themselves around repetitions: the same corridors, the same staircases, the same house, the same pursuits, the same delays, the same teeth breaking, the same phone that doesn't work, the same person appearing abnormally. For Noctis, repetition is the primary information. It indicates a psychic loop: an unresolved conflict, a postponed decision, an unacknowledged emotion, or a boundary you don't set. He helps you distinguish the setting (the "theme") from the event (the "trigger"), and understand what your mind is trying to process at night to avoid overwhelming you during the day.
Noctis also makes a point of contextualizing: the same symbol doesn't carry the same meaning depending on your history, your values, and your life stage. An "ocean" can represent freedom for one person and loss of control for another. A "house" can be a refuge, or a past that holds you back. The symbol is not a verdict: it is a mirror. Noctis helps you clean it so it reflects more clearly.
The hidden need: behind the shadow, a clear request
Shadow dreams are not made to punish you. They often reveal a need that has not found a direct outlet. Example: if you dream of being chased, the need might be safety, but also truth (stop lying to yourself), or boundaries (stop exposing yourself). If you dream of being watched, the need might be protection, but also recognition (you want to be seen, but not judged). If you dream of losing your belongings, the need might be grounding, or control, or simplification (you're carrying too much).
Noctis doesn't just name the need. He shows you how it manifests during the day: micro-events, automatic reactions, avoided choices, repetitive scenarios. The goal is to transform the dream into usable information: not a strange story, but a discreet inner diagnosis. The more you understand the need, the less the dream needs to repeat the symbol.
A distinctive feature of Noctis: he identifies the "secondary benefits" of recurring dreams. Some dreams protect a self-image, family loyalty, a relational strategy, or an old survival mechanism. As long as this mechanism remains useful, the unconscious defends it. Noctis helps you negotiate: keep the protection, but change the form. This is often where relief begins.
